Corpus Christi Veterans Memorial had already won 15 in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 6 runs) and they went ahead and made it 16 on Saturday. They were the clear victors by an 8-2 margin over the Miller Buccaneers. The result was nothing new for the Eagles, who have now won 11 contests by six runs or more so far this season.
Julian Colsa made a splash no matter where he played. He pitched two innings while giving up no earned runs or hits. What's more, he posted three strikeouts, the most he's had since back in March. He was also big at the plate, going 1-for-2 with one run, one double, and one RBI.
In other batting news, Davian Garcia and MJ Vela did most of the damage at the plate: Garcia went a perfect 2-for-2 with two runs, one triple, and one RBI, while Vela went 1-for-2 with three stolen bases, two runs, and one double. That's the most stolen bases Vela has posted since back in March. Aaron Gonzalez was another key player, going a perfect 1-for-1 with two stolen bases, one run, and one RBI.
Corpus Christi Veterans Memorial pushed their record up to 24-2-1 with the victory, which was their eighth straight at home. Those home w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 7.1 runs over those games. As for Miller, they are on a 14-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 5-21.
